Eucharistic Minister (EM)
Eucharistic Ministers are ministers of Holy Communion. They assist the ordinary ministers of communion in celebrations where additional communion stations are necessary.

Positions Available
We are always seeking individuals to join our ministry. You MUST be 18 years old, baptized, and confirmed.
5:00 p.m., 8:00 a.m. or 10:00 a.m. Eucharistic Minister
We typically have 4 Eucharistic Ministers help at each Mass - 2 with the host and 2 with the sacramental wine.
Eucharistic Minister to the Sick
Specially trained EM volunteers assist with communion calls to the sick and homebound.
